1 Samuel 3:1-4:1a; John 20:21-23

October 17, 2021
Narrative Lectionary Year 4, Week 6

Invocational Prayer
Jesus, bringer of peace, and sender of the Spirit:
Even if it feels early for a Sunday morning and we want to go lay down again, we are here because you have called.  We gather now for worship, through the word, song, and prayer in the house of the Lord.  The lamp of God is not extinguished, but it burns in our hearts and your servants are listening.  Amen.

Prayer of Preparation
Light of God
We want our ears to tingle and we don’t want to let any of these words fall to ground because you, O Lord, are revealed through this word.  Let we your servants listen as we now say “Speak Lord.”
Amen

Offering Prayer
God revealed through the word of the prophets, God who is revealed as the Word, God sends the Spirit of Peace:
We give you thanks for all the blessings provided to us.  We pray Lord that through the gifts we offer, you would be revealed to our church, our community, and even the whole world.  Let us hide nothing from you, but give of ourselves fully, to be used as your servants.  And let the work we do be good in your eyes.  Amen.

Intercessory Prayer
Lord who has spoken through the prophets:
Your people now speak to you, asking for your word to be revealed to them through the mercies that they seek.  Nothing is hidden from you, and so you are already aware of the needs of the world that include disease, death, destruction, despair, and depression.  You are already aware of the needs of the world that include addiction, abuse, animosity, and anxiety.  You are aware of these and so many more.  We know that we may sometimes be unfaithful and the words you speak fall to the ground.  But we do wish to take full advantage of the sacrifice of Jesus Christ that atones for sins and we pray that the sins of the world would soon be ended and these problems would be healed.  We pray it in His holy name, with His prayer.
Our Father… Amen.

Benediction
It is not for us to do what is good in our eyes
But to do what is good in His eyes
The Father has seen it is good to provide His blessing of forgiveness
  Through His Son
The Father has seen it is good to provide His blessing of peace
  Through His Spirit
In the Precious, Holy Name of these Three
AMEN
